# Siena to Montepulciano: Wine and Renaissance
Montepulciano is famous for Vino Nobile and for its dramatic hilltop position. It is one of the easiest serious day trips from Siena.
Key facts
- Bus 112 from Siena: 1h30, ~7 euro.
- By car: 1h10 via SR2. Better for combining stops.
- Highlights: Piazza Grande, Palazzo Comunale (climb the tower), Cantina Contucci wine cellar.
- Wine tastings at major cantinas: 15-30 euro per person.
- Lunch tip: avoid the main piazza for value. Side streets have better trattorias.
What I tell visitors
Combine with Pienza and Bagno Vignoni for a full Val d'Orcia day. Even by bus this is doable if you plan return times carefully.
